Rapper Has No Love For Wannabe Hood Rats
Mar 13, 2009
Jay Z continues to be one of the few keeping it real by confessing he hates hearing his rap contemporaries bleat on about 'keeping it hood'.
Even though the hit maker is often criticized for failing to keep in touch with his roots (the deprived Bedford-Stuyvesant district of Brooklyn, New York), he is adamant no rap star would give up the bling, ladies and luxury fame has afforded them to go live in the ghetto.
He says, "I think it's more important for me to be in touch with who I am than in touch with the streets, per se. Being in touch with the streets, keeping it real, that's become a lie and a cliche.
"I'm not hanging on the corner in the Bed-Stuy. I hate it when rappers say, 'I'm keeping it hood.' I'm like, 'Why? What do you mean? No one's there by choice! You're in the hood, by choice?!'"
